Dana White claims that Paulo Costa is lying about his contract. As per the UFC president, the Brazilian is being paid much more than he is letting on.

Since last year specifically, Costa has been quite vocal about low fighter compensation in the UFC. In a recent interview with The MMA Hour, 'Borrachinha' claimed that the promotion tried to renew his contract, offering him an abysmal six-fight deal worth just $500K.

However, speaking on Bussin' With The Boys YouTube channel, White addressed the fighter pay issue and clapped back on Costa's claims, stating that the Brazilian was lying about the contract offer:

"I just had a situation recently and I'll tell you who it was. It was Paulo Costa. He is a f****g lunatic. He acts like a lunatic. And he came out publicly and kind of said what we offered him. It was the farthest f****g thing from the truth."

White continues to express his displeasure with the situation by saying:

"This was a while ago and this is the first time I've even talked about it, but it's just an example. See, these guys will say stuff like that because they know I won't talk about it publically. I really don't give a s**t."

When Dana White explained why UFC fighters can't be paid like boxers

Dana White believes that a company like UFC will surely go out of business if all fighters on its roster were to be paid humongous sums akin to what many boxers are paid.

During an interview on The Pivot Podcast, the UFC president suggested that most boxers are overpaid and explained why the UFC's payment format is different:

"With boxing too all those f*****g guys are overpaid and every time they put on a fight it's a going out of business sale. You know what I mean. [It's like] we're going to get as much money as we can from you guys and then we're out of here. See you in three years."

White further explained his thoughts on how a business runs:

"You can't build a league like that, you can't build a sport [like that]. You can't have 750 fighters under contract making money, feeding their families every year with that kind of mentality. It doesn't work. You have to run a business."
